Written question asked by Bishop of Oxford (Bishops (affiliation)) on Thursday, 26 June 2025, in the House of Lords. It was due for an answer on Thursday, 10 July 2025. It was answered by Baroness Smith of Malvern (Labour) on Thursday, 10 July 2025 on behalf of the Department for Education.
Adoption and Special Guardianship Support Fund
- Question
-
To ask His Majesty's Government what plans they have to assess the impact of the adoption and special guardianship support fund changes on (1) adoptive and kinship placement disruption, and (2) adopter recruitment.
- Answer
-
The new criteria for the Adoption and Special Guardianship Support Fund will enable as many children and families as possible to access the available funding. The department always assesses the impact of changes on vulnerable children. This includes reviewing the equalities impact assessment, which will be made available in the House Libraries in due course.
The department routinely monitors data on adoptive and kinship placement disruption, as well as on adopter recruitment. The department is working closely with Adoption England to improve its monitoring of placement disruption and is funding them to deliver specific projects designed to improve adopter recruitment and family support.
